ABSTRACT:
A microporous material substrate is coated with a coating composition comprising a volatile aqueous liquid medium and binder dissolved or dispersed in the volatile aqueous liquid medium, wherein the binder comprises film-forming organic polymer comprising: (a) water-soluble poly(ethylene oxide) having a weight average molecular weight in the range of from 100,000 to 3,000,000, and (b) water-soluble or water-dispersible crosslinkable urethane-acrylate hybrid polymer. Finely divided substantially water-insoluble filler particles may optionally be present in the coating composition. After drying and crosslinking, the peel strength between the coating and the microporous material substrate is high. The coating may be inkjet printed. The printed coating may be coated by or laminated to a substantially transparent protective layer.
